Can 21 year-old Terry Fox, a cancer survivor with a prosthetic leg, run the length of Canada?

Nicola Coughlan shines a light on extraordinary young people from across history. Join her for 12 stories of rebellion, risk and the radical power of youth.

A BBC Studios Audio production for BBC Radio 4 and BBC Sounds.
